How to Buy Online with Bitcoin Without a CVV

You can buy physical and digital products from thousands of legitimate stores with Bitcoin. The checkout process does not ask for a CVV because Bitcoin is not a credit card. This is the safe way to spend Bitcoin.

  1. Set up a Bitcoin wallet such as a hardware wallet or a reputable mobile app.
  2. Buy Bitcoin through an exchange that verifies your identity, like Coinbase or Kraken.
  3. Find stores that accept Bitcoin directly or through services like BitPay.
  4. At checkout, choose Bitcoin, scan the QR code, and confirm the payment in your wallet.

Parameters That Keep a Crypto Purchase Legitimate

Stick to merchants with clear return policies and customer support. Use payment processors that handle crypto conversions because they provide order confirmation. Never send Bitcoin to an individual wallet for a deal that sounds too good.

Keep records of the transaction. The receipt from a crypto payment is a record you can use if the order fails. That record is the difference between shopping and committing wire fraud.

Pitfalls of Attempting to Purchase CVV with Bitcoin

First, you lose money. CVV sellers frequent the dark web and do not care about buyer protection. Second, you get tied to a crime. Paying for stolen card data with Bitcoin is an act that supports fraud. Third, your bank or exchange may freeze your account if it detects suspicious activity.

If you think a Bitcoin address makes you anonymous, you are wrong. Modern exchanges link your identity to that address. Investigators can trace payments to CVV shops.
